Wahl Accounting Scholarship Details
St. Ambrose University provides up to $3,500 to one accounting major each year through the Wahl Accounting Scholarship. Explore the requirements and application process below.
Wahl Accounting Scholarship eligibility details
Wahl Accounting Scholarship details
The Wahl Accounting Scholarship is available to full-time accounting majors. This scholarship gives preference to a rising senior in the accounting program.
Student eligibility and enrollment requirements:
- Enrollment in the BBA of Accounting program at St. Ambrose University
- GPA of at least 3.0 on a 4.0 scale
- Students must reapply for the Wahl Accounting Scholarship each year
Each year, one accounting major receives the Wahl Accounting Scholarship. This award is available to full-time undergraduate students with a preference for a rising senior.
The Wahl Accounting Scholarship is disbursed following a straightforward process:
- The Accounting Department shares a list of recipients with Financial Services.
- Disbursement occurs at the beginning of each year.
- Funds are directly credited to your account and applied toward tuition.

How to apply for the Wahl Accounting Scholarship
Applying for a scholarship is easy. Follow these steps.
Apply to SAU
To qualify for the Wahl Accounting Scholarship, you need to apply to SAU and meet eligibility requirements. Complete the application and enroll at SAU.
Submit your application
The application for Accounting Scholarships typically opens in April. Submit your application to be considered for the Wahl Accounting Scholarship.
Contact Financial Aid with questions
If you have questions about Accounting Scholarships, please reach out to Financial Aid for support.
